WebApr 5, 2024 · So, if you have a taxable income of £37,000, you would pay 20% Income Tax on £24,430 (£37,000 minus the Personal Allowance of £12,570). Need to know! These … WebApr 6, 2024 · All three tax rates are unchanged from 2024/21. The personal allowance is set at £12,570 for 2024/22. Both the allowance and the basic rate limit have been increased in line with inflation from 2024/21. As a result the higher rate threshold – the point at which individuals become liable to pay tax at the higher rate – is £50,270 for 2024/22. Web1 day ago · Scottish Tax Bands. WebIn simple terms, income tax relief allows you to exclude some of your income from assessment for income tax in exchange for making a pension contribution What this means is that if you earn £50,000 but receive tax relief on £10,000 of your income, you will pay tax as though you were earning only £40,000 instead.
